I’m just a little too young to remember the 1982 World Cup, so can’t claim to have been inspired by one of the greatest matches of all time, not legitimately anyway. That game, Brazil versus Italy in the group stages at the Estadio Sarria, knocked arguably one of the best Brazilian sides assembled out of the World Cup, whilst simultaneously setting Italy on the path to ultimately win the tournament. It also served as a redemption arc for the Italian striker Paolo Rossi. Implicated, and subsequently banned for two years for his involvement in a match-fixing scandal, his hat-trick in the game set him on his way to win the Golden Boot as tournament top scorer, Golden Ball as the tournament’s best player, and eventually World and European Footballer of the Year.   Basingstoke Town Women 2 Weymouth Women 4 10 th September 2023. **Warning – contains swearing** Jill Scott. A Lioness. A certified legend of English football. A “heads up” type of player in that she would already have picked out her next pass or move before she had received the ball. Excellent control, skillful, with an uncanny ability to pick the right pass, whether it be a through ball to unlock a defence, or simply playing the ball to a teammate to start another attack. Everything I’ve ever seen of her in the media also suggests she is a genuinely nice human being. I’ve watched her play live twice, and both times took time away from supporting one of the teams, to just watch her on the ball. The fitting end to her career was being part of England’s successful European Championship victory in 2022, a career that saw her traverse the dawn of professionalism in women’s football in this country.
